What are 'Paid Social Ads' ? 


Detailed Description

Paid Social Ads refer to the practice of paying for advertisements that are displayed on social media platforms. These ads are targeted based on user behavior, demographics, and preferences, which are collected by the social media platforms through user interactions and engagements.

The primary goal of paid social ads is to enhance brand visibility, promote products or services, and drive user engagement and conversions.

In the context of customer success management, paid social ads play a crucial role in acquiring new customers, retaining existing ones, and increasing overall customer satisfaction by delivering personalized ad experiences. These ads can be used to solve common problems such as low brand awareness, slow customer acquisition rates, and poor customer engagement by directly addressing the target audience in a space where they spend a significant amount of time.


Common Questions and Solutions in Paid Social Ads

  • How do I target the right audience? Utilize the detailed targeting options provided by social platforms, such as age, location, interests, and past purchasing behavior.
  • What is the cost of Paid Social Ads? Costs can vary widely based on the competition for the audience, the platform chosen, and the ad format. Most platforms offer a pay-per-click (PPC) model.
  • How can I measure the effectiveness of my ads? Use platform-specific analytics tools to track metrics such as impressions, clicks, conversion rates, and ROI.

Examples of 'Paid Social Ads'

Here are a few practical examples and case studies:

  • Facebook Ads for E-commerce: An e-commerce brand used Facebook's dynamic product ads to retarget visitors who abandoned their shopping carts. The ads displayed the specific products that the users had added to their carts, resulting in a 50% increase in conversion rates.
  • Instagram Influencer Collaborations: A beauty brand collaborated with influencers on Instagram to create sponsored posts that showcased their products. This strategy enhanced their reach and credibility, leading to a 30% increase in sales during the campaign period.

Implementation Recommendations for 'Paid Social Ads'

To effectively implement paid social ads, consider the following best practices:

  • Define Clear Objectives: Determine what you want to achieve with your ads, such as increasing brand awareness, boosting sales, or driving traffic to your website.
  • Choose the Right Platforms: Select social media platforms that are most popular with your target audience. For instance, LinkedIn is ideal for B2B marketing, while Instagram may be better for lifestyle and retail brands.
  • Use High-Quality Visuals: Since social media is highly visual, use high-quality images or videos to grab attention and make your ads stand out.
  • Test and Optimize: Continuously test different ad formats, copy, and visuals to see what works best. Use A/B testing and adapt based on performance data.
  • Track and Measure Performance: Utilize analytics tools to track the performance of your ads and make data-driven decisions to optimize your strategy.
